What Are Arrhythmias?

Arrhythmias are disruptions in your heart’s normal rhythm, causing it to beat too fast, too slow, or irregularly. These rhythm changes can make you notice symptoms like palpitations, skipped beats, or feeling lightheaded. Your heart’s electrical system controls its rhythm, and disruptions in this system lead to various arrhythmia types.

Types of arrhythmias affecting men include atrial fibrillation, which causes fast irregular beats, bradycardia, which slows your heartbeat, and ventricular tachycardia, which speeds it up dangerously. Symptoms range from mild fluttering to chest pain or fainting, depending on the arrhythmia type and your overall health.

Factors that trigger arrhythmias in men include high blood pressure, stress, stimulant use like caffeine or nicotine, sleep apnea, and existing heart disease. Common Causes of Arrhythmias

Arrhythmias often result from imbalances or disruptions that alter your heart’s normal electrical pathways. Recognizing these causes helps you choose the right at-home testing and make informed choices about your health.

Heart Conditions and Structural Issues

Heart conditions and structural abnormalities frequently contribute to arrhythmias in men. Congenital heart defects, coronary artery disease, previous heart attack, and heart failure can change the muscle or electrical system, leading to abnormal rhythms. Scar tissue from surgery or untreated high blood pressure also triggers irregular heartbeats.

Lifestyle and Environmental Factors

Lifestyle and environmental influences frequently affect your heart’s rhythm. High intake of caffeine, regular alcohol use, tobacco products, recreational drugs like cocaine, and unmanaged stress or anxiety disrupt cardiac electrical flow. Intense exercise, sleep apnea, and obesity additionally increase arrhythmia risk by putting excess strain on cardiac function.

Medications and Substances

Medications and substances sometimes provoke arrhythmias. Over-the-counter cold medicines, asthma inhalers, and certain antidepressants or antiarrhythmic drugs alter your heart’s signaling patterns. Misuse of supplements or performance-enhancing substances can also destabilize your heart’s rhythm, emphasizing the importance of reviewing all substances you’re taking when exploring at-home health testing options.

Recognizing the Symptoms of Arrhythmias

Spotting arrhythmia symptoms early can help you take action on your heart health at home. Symptoms often appear during common activities, especially if you already monitor your health with wearables or home ECG devices.

  • Palpitations

You may feel your heart racing, pounding, or skipping beats, often unexpectedly. For example, during workouts, stressful moments, or even when resting, your heart might feel fluttery or irregular.

  • Lightheadedness or Dizziness

You may notice sudden spells of lightheadedness, especially when standing quickly or after exertion. Some men also report brief dizziness following heavy lifting or running.

  • Shortness of Breath

You might find it hard to catch your breath with minimal effort, such as walking up stairs or carrying groceries, if your rhythm becomes irregular.

  • Fatigue

Persistent tiredness after routine activities, like mowing the lawn or playing with kids, can signal an underlying arrhythmia, especially if you usually recover quickly.

  • Chest Discomfort

Some men experience mild chest pain, tightness, or pressure during arrhythmia episodes. Chest symptoms linked to irregular rhythms can vary, and home monitoring can help track patterns.

  • Fainting (Syncope)

Infrequent fainting during exercise or everyday movement may point to more serious arrhythmias. If you track heart data at home, sudden drops in your readings could connect to these episodes.

Diagnostic Testing for Arrhythmias

Diagnostic testing for arrhythmias pinpoints irregular heart rhythms and guides your next steps. Home-friendly tools and tests provide practical options for men serious about understanding their heart health.

Electrocardiogram (ECG/EKG)

Electrocardiograms (ECG/EKG) measure your heart’s electrical signals. In at-home settings, portable ECG devices produce real-time tracings, capturing arrhythmias like atrial fibrillation or premature beats. You get clear records to share with your healthcare provider for expert review. Most devices sync with smartphones and alert users when patterns deviate, improving early detection for men monitoring their symptoms.

Holter Monitors and Event Recorders

Holter monitors and event recorders provide extended rhythm tracking. Wearable Holter monitors record continuous ECG data for 24-48 hours. Event recorders, sometimes incorporated into smart wearables, capture readings only when you notice symptoms or press a button. For men with infrequent palpitations, event recorders offer a flexible testing option, as they catch episodes missed by traditional monitoring.

Additional Advanced Testing Methods

Additional advanced testing methods diagnose complex or hidden arrhythmias. Stress tests measure your heart’s rhythm during physical activity—ideal if exercise triggers symptoms. Implantable loop recorders store months of rhythm data, which suits men with rare but severe symptom episodes. Electrophysiology studies map your heart’s internal electrical system, but these tests usually occur in specialized centers when non-invasive options miss crucial details.

Treatment Options for Arrhythmias

Managing arrhythmias depends on your specific diagnosis, the underlying causes identified in testing, and your unique health profile. Clinicians usually recommend a combination of lifestyle changes, medications, and medical interventions to help stabilize your heart rhythm and reduce risks.

Lifestyle Adjustments

Adopting tailored lifestyle adjustments improves your heart’s electrical stability, especially following at-home test results confirming rhythm irregularities.

  • Reducing caffeine intake, for example, swapping energy drinks for water
  • Limiting alcohol, such as cutting back on beer or spirits
  • Quitting smoking
  • Managing stress through guided meditation apps or physical activity

Medications

Doctors prescribe medications after analyzing your arrhythmia type and frequency using wearable ECG data or home monitoring results.

  • Antiarrhythmic drugs, including amiodarone or flecainide, target abnormal rhythms
  • Beta blockers, like metoprolol, help slow the heart rate
  • Anticoagulants, such as warfarin or newer agents, reduce stroke risk in atrial fibrillation cases

Non-Surgical Procedures

Interventional therapies address persistent or dangerous arrhythmias identified in your testing data.

  • Cardioversion, by delivering a mild electric shock, restores normal rhythm in atrial fibrillation
  • Catheter ablation, often for tachycardias, uses heat or cold to destroy problematic heart tissue
  • Pacemaker implantation stabilizes low heart rates

Device-Based Treatments

Implantable devices offer a long-term rhythm solution when monitoring confirms severe arrhythmias.

  • Pacemakers regulate bradycardia or slow heart rhythms
  • Implantable cardioverter-defibrillators (ICDs) correct dangerous fast rhythms found using home or clinical ECGs

Follow-Up and Monitoring

Ongoing rhythm monitoring helps track treatment progress for chronic cases.

  • Mobile ECG patches or smartwatches compare new data to earlier baselines
  • Regular check-ins with your provider ensure medications and devices remain effective
